ARC Raiders Assorted Seeds Guide | Trading, Recycling & Farming Methods

Category: ARC Raiders Posted: Jan 04, 2026 Views: 3547

In ARC Raiders, every item has its own function and purpose. Some are weapons that can be used directly in combat, some are raw materials that can be processed into higher-level items, and then there are miscellaneous items, such as assorted seeds.

These seeds are not part of ARC Raiders crafting system and cannot be recycled, but they can help complete specific tasks or be sold for more coins, allowing you to trade for other materials you need when resources are scarce.

What are assorted seeds?

Assorted seeds is the general term used in ARC Raiders for these seeds, as they cannot be categorized and grown into specific crops through planting. Players usually refer to them simply as seeds.

The main uses of ARC Raiders assorted seeds are three: trading with NPC Celeste, selling them for coins (each worth 100 coins), and completing the quest Root of the Matter.

What items does Celeste sell?

There are multiple NPCs in ARC Raiders, some of whom not only have their own storylines but also run shops where you can obtain additional resources.

Currently known vendor NPCs include Celeste, Tian Wen, Apollo, Shani, and Lance, but only Celeste accepts seeds as currency instead of ARC Raiders coins. The tradeable materials and the required number of seeds for interacting with her are as follows:

  • Chemicals: 1 Seed
  • Fabric: 1 Seed
  • Metal Parts: 1 Seed
  • Plastic Parts: 1 Seed
  • Rubber Parts: 1 Seed
  • Heavy Gun Parts: 15 Seeds
  • Light Gun Parts: 15 Seeds
  • Medium Gun Parts: 15 Seeds
  • Moss: 10 Seeds
  • Processor: 10 Seeds
  • Rope: 10 Seeds
  • Sensors: 10 Seeds
  • Speaker Component: 10 Seeds
  • Synthesized Fuel: 14 Seeds
  • Syringe: 10 Seeds
  • Voltage Converter: 10 Seeds
  • Battery: 5 Seeds
  • Canister: 6 Seeds
  • Duct Tape: 6 Seeds
  • Great Mullein: 5 Seeds
  • Magnet: 6 Seeds
  • Oil: 6 Seeds
  • Simple Gun Parts: 7 Seeds
  • Steel Spring: 6 Seeds
  • Wires: 4 Seeds
  • Complex Gun Parts: 60 Seeds
  • Exodus Modules: 55 Seeds

Some of these items can also be obtained by crafting using relevant materials and blueprints, but most are raw materials for crafting higher-level items. In addition, all the above items can be sold for varying amounts of coins.

How to complete Root of the Matter quest?

This quest is given by Celeste. First, you need to travel to Buried City map and enter Research Building. The building has entrances on all four sides, so it's relatively easy to enter while minimizing the chance of encountering enemies.

After entering the building and eliminating some ARC enemies, the quest will further require you to find the seed vault in the "room with a great view".

This room is located in the center of the first floor of the building. If you can see Marano Park from the window after entering, you've found the right room. Then you will see the seed vault on the left side of the room; interacting with it will drop an Experimental Seed Sample.

Next, take the sample back and give it to Celeste to complete the quest. You will then receive 1000 coins and a succulent-shaped backpack charm as a reward.

Although this quest doesn't reward you with seeds, it clarifies the existence of seeds in the game, preparing you for subsequent mechanics and gameplay related to seeds.

How to obtain seeds?

Roughly speaking, there are two ways to obtain seeds in ARC Raiders: scavenging and recycling, but each can be further refined, and we will introduce them to you one by one.

Scavenging seed vault in Stella Montis

While the seed vault in specific missions is located in Buried City, the seed vault in Stella Montis is a better option for actually earning seeds, as many of the containers hidden there primarily drop seeds.

Note that this seed vault requires a fuel cell to open. If you want to find this item yourself, you should focus on areas near your extraction point. Then, insert the battery into the seed vault's panel to open it and scavenge the containers.

It's important to note that to prevent being robbed by other players, it's best to immediately put the seeds into your Safe Pocket after obtaining them. In the best-case scenario, this method can yield over 100 seeds at once.

Scavenging other specific containers

Besides seed vaults, plant boxes in outdoor areas marked as "natural" on all maps, and containers marked as natural resources, also have a very high chance of dropping seeds. Alternatively, you can focus on scavenging the following containers:

  • Seed Drawer Box
  • Red Locker
  • Green Locker
  • Fridge

Finding Wicker Baskets

This special container appears when Lush Blooms and Cold Snap events occur on the map and occasionally spawns in the cafeteria on Stella Montis. Besides seeds, you can also find other fruits or plant-related items in this container.

Waiting for Scrappy to generate seeds

Scrappy is a mechanical rooster stationed at your base that produces extra resources for you while you're out fighting, including seeds. Scrappy can be upgraded to level 5 (Master Hoarder), and the higher the level, the more seeds it generates.

Recycling other natural items

If you have extra fruits or plant items, you can choose to recycle them to obtain seeds. The recycling rates are as follows:

  • Sample Cleaner: 14 Seeds
  • Agave: 3 Seeds
  • Apricot: 3 Seeds
  • Lemon: 3 Seeds
  • Moss: 3 Seeds
  • Prickly Pear: 3 Seeds
  • Candleberries: 2 Seeds
  • Fertilizer: 2 Seeds
  • Great Mullein: 2 Seeds
  • Herbal Bandage: 2 Seeds
  • Olives: 2 Seeds
  • Roots: 1 Seed

Since seeds are not further categorized, they will be stacked together in a single inventory slot, with a maximum of 100 seeds per slot. To use them, simply open your inventory and click on them.
